Pollen @ Gardens by the Bay (4Aug12)

Can't remember for what occasion we decided to go to Pollen. Cute buggy service from the carpark to the restaurant. Useful on a rainy day. Clueless visitors were hoping to catch a ride but this is exclusively for patrons only. Love the concept. Lots of natural light and nature. Peaceful ambience notwithstanding other diners.

We picked 2 set lunches (menu changes periodically) and added Sydney Rock Oysters which were nice and fresh. Can't remember what tartare I had. It was alright. Slow-cooked egg was good, risotto was not bad but a tad heavy, pork belly was good and the desserts decent. There's nothing very wow about the food but good enough for us to return, especially with the reasonably-priced set lunch and wine.

What's cool is that you get free entry to the Flower Dome and Cloud Forest at Gardens by the Bay. Only because the restaurant is in the dome itself! After you're done with a satisfying meal, just walk out there and enjoy an afternoon stroll in the cooled conservatories. Pleasurable indeed. We didn't venture out to the supertrees though.
Name: Pollen (website)
Location: Flower Dome, Gardens By The Bay, 18 Marina Gardens Drive #01-09 Singapore 018953
Expenditure: ~S$200+ for 2 set lunch, 1 entree, 1 bot of wine
